Understanding the Anatomy of a Sink Skirt

A sink skirt is essentially the base panel connecting your countertop to the wall-mounted structure below. It acts as a bridge between these two components, providing stability while housing vital infrastructure such as pipes, drains, and electrical wiring.

Made primarily from materials like laminated wood, MDF (medium-density fiberboard), or solid surface composites, each material brings distinct advantages. Laminated wood offers durability against moisture, whereas MDF provides smooth surfaces ideal for custom finishes. Solid surface options combine strength with aesthetic flexibility.

Differentiation from other vanity components: Unlike countertops which bear direct contact with water and items placed upon them, sink skirts remain largely hidden but critical to overall functionality. They serve as protective barriers against potential leaks and damage rather than being subjected to wear themselves.

The dimensions of a standard sink skirt vary based on vanity size and style preferences. Typically ranging between 6 inches to 18 inches in height depending on whether it’s part of a freestanding unit or mounted within cabinetry.

Selecting the Right Material for Your Space

Choosing appropriate materials involves considering several factors including humidity levels present in different areas of your home versus those found outdoors where sink skirts might occasionally be exposed.

Laminate surfaces excel at resisting scratches and stains caused by everyday usage patterns typical inside bathrooms. However, prolonged exposure could lead gradual degradation unless properly sealed against moisture ingress.

MDF boards provide excellent flatness required for seamless integration with adjacent walls but require careful sealing methods to prevent swelling due to high ambient moisture conditions common near sinks.

Solid surface products made from acrylic resins demonstrate exceptional resilience towards thermal changes making them particularly well-suited environments prone fluctuating temperatures like those encountered frequently within kitchens connected via shared utility spaces.
